National Sexual Assault Hotline: 1-800-656-HOPE
If you or someone you are connected with has experienced sexual assault, please remember that you are not alone. There is help available, and reaching out can be the first step toward healing. The National Sexual Assault Hotline provides confidential and free support any time to those affected.
You can call them at 1-800-656-HOPE, or go to their website at RAINN.org for more resources. Remember, healing takes, and there are people who want to support you.
Seeking Support : Childhelp USA
If you or someone you know is experiencing abuse or neglect, please understand that help is available. You can speak Childhelp USA's 24/7 national hotline at 1-800-422-4453. They offer secure support and resources for children, teens, and adults who are dealing with difficult situations. Childhelp USA is dedicated to helping children and families by providing understanding assistance. Don't hesitate to find the help you need.
